How about a 60 sec. auto refresh of the New Post search located here:

http://forums.gtplanet.net/search.php?s=&action=getnew

It would be nice in my situation on how I use the forum, but don't know how many other's use this feature often. It would probably help prolong the life of my left button on my mouse...

Thanks for reading....

Oh and.... This meta tag could be added pretty painlessly:

PHP:
<META HTTP-EQUIV="refresh" CONTENT="60; URL=search.php?s=&action=getnew">

I was actually talking about this last night. Is there a way that you could "automatically" refresh the page while staying in the thread that your in? Or have the page refresh when a new post is made?
 
No there really isn't unless you wanted to open up your computer for complete access to your system's resources, which I don't think you want.

Bulletin boards seem dynamic, but are infact static, in that you don't get live data, only a series of updates from queries done on the database. But that would be killer if the refreash would be triggered by an event such as a person submitting a post.
